About The Position

The Residential Assistant Property Manger assists in the execution of strategic business plans and in leading day-to-day operations for an assigned residential building. The Residential Assistant Manager is a gatekeeper of accuracy and ensures accounting and administrative functions are conducted with precision. The Assistant Manager is a team leader and offers coaching and support to associates. They lead the team by example and ensure service and sales standards exceed customer expectation as well as ensure the property achieves established financial and operational goals.

Responsibilities

  • Manage, create, and maintain monthly A/R duties including but not limited to payment processing and management, “Pre- Month End” and “Accounting Month End” reports.
  • Administer and maintain all administrative duties related to A/P, active purchase order system then coding invoices, and submitting them to the Head Office within the mandated time frame.
  • Oversee, prepare, and carry out legal processes, weekly reporting, rent collection, delinquency management, Notices to Pay Rent or Quit, evictions, collections, Covid-19 moratorium understanding and updates, and balanced owed letters.
